Those cards ran hot anyway, I would make sure your case is clean of dust and rest easy, it sounds fine. If you are weary, just run any gpu temperature tool and watch it. its safe to call anything around 60c at idle or low usage okay, and anything over 90c while gaming, just listen for the fan to kick up. also, its best to just let it set the fan speed automatically most of the time.
